The present study suggests early onset disruption of whole-brain white matter connectivity in patients with aMCI, especially in those with the MD subtype, supporting the view that MD aMCI is a more advanced form of disease than is SD aMCI. Moreover, cognitive correlations with topological network properties suggest their potential use as markers to assess the risk of Alzheimer disease.
